Let me break it down like this linehaul makes more money it's not even close, so if money is what you are after go linehaul. I have a small route 380 miles a night usually 9-10 hours since I have 4 drop and hooks. So for 45-50 hours of work a week I'm going to make 70k this year. I think the best a city guy hits is maybe the low 60s

Well the vast majority of linehaul work is over night, City guys is all day shift. Reasonable expectation of pay is at least 40k for city and a minimum 60k for linehaul. I work with guys in linehaul pulling 6 figures working 60 hour weeks. It's all about your preference, not everyone can handle nights.

Due to my schedule I did the interview and then another day I did the physical drug test and road test. Orientation lasted about 3 hours, lots of paperwork and videos. Training consisted of one week with the driver trainer. The TM did the interview and orientation no out of state recruiter crap like some other companies.
